Paul at Mars Hill discusses the futility of idols and philosophies in contrast to the fulfillment found in Jesus.
Paul at Mars Hill shares the gospel after being greatly distressed by all of the idols in Athens as well as by the Epicurean and Stoic philosophers. Idols and philosophies never deliver fully on what they are promising. The give you just enough to keep you coming back but never leave you satisfied. Meaning, purpose, and abundant life can only be found in Jesus!
